106 changes: 106 additions & 0 deletions src/System.CommandLine.Tests/ParserTests.RootCommandAndArg0.cs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,106 @@
// Copyright (c) .NET Foundation and contributors. All rights reserved.
// Licensed under the MIT license. See LICENSE file in the project root for full license information.

using System.CommandLine.Parsing;
using System.Linq;
using FluentAssertions;
using Xunit;

namespace System.CommandLine.Tests;

public partial class ParserTests
{
public partial class RootCommandAndArg0
{
[Fact]
public void When_parsing_a_string_array_a_root_command_can_be_omitted_from_the_parsed_args()
{
var command = new Command("outer")
{
new Command("inner")
{
new Option<string>("-x")
}
};

var result1 = command.Parse(Split("inner -x hello"));
var result2 = command.Parse(Split("outer inner -x hello"));

result1.Diagram().Should().Be(result2.Diagram());
}

[Fact]
public void When_parsing_a_string_array_input_then_a_full_path_to_an_executable_is_not_matched_by_the_root_command()
{
var command = new RootCommand
{
new Command("inner")
{
new Option<string>("-x")
}
};

command.Parse(Split("inner -x hello")).Errors.Should().BeEmpty();

command.Parse(Split($"{RootCommand.ExecutablePath} inner -x hello"))
.Errors
.Should()
.ContainSingle(e => e.Message == $"{LocalizationResources.Instance.UnrecognizedCommandOrArgument(RootCommand.ExecutablePath)}");
}

[Fact]
public void When_parsing_an_unsplit_string_a_root_command_can_be_omitted_from_the_parsed_args()
{
var command = new Command("outer")
{
new Command("inner")
{
new Option<string>("-x")
}
};

var result1 = command.Parse("inner -x hello");
var result2 = command.Parse("outer inner -x hello");

result1.Diagram().Should().Be(result2.Diagram());
}

[Fact]
public void When_parsing_an_unsplit_string_then_input_a_full_path_to_an_executable_is_matched_by_the_root_command()
{
var command = new RootCommand
{
new Command("inner")
{
new Option<string>("-x")
}
};

var result2 = command.Parse($"{RootCommand.ExecutablePath} inner -x hello");

result2.RootCommandResult.Token.Value.Should().Be(RootCommand.ExecutablePath);
}

[Fact]
public void When_parsing_an_unsplit_string_then_a_renamed_RootCommand_can_be_omitted_from_the_parsed_args()
{
var rootCommand = new RootCommand
{
new Command("inner")
{
new Option<string>("-x")
}
};
rootCommand.Name = "outer";

var result1 = rootCommand.Parse("inner -x hello");
var result2 = rootCommand.Parse("outer inner -x hello");
var result3 = rootCommand.Parse($"{RootCommand.ExecutableName} inner -x hello");

result2.RootCommandResult.Command.Should().BeSameAs(result1.RootCommandResult.Command);
result3.RootCommandResult.Command.Should().BeSameAs(result1.RootCommandResult.Command);
}

string[] Split(string value) => CommandLineStringSplitter.Instance.Split(value).ToArray();
}
}
